Passport & Visa Requirements

Travellers must ensure they hold a valid passport, visa, and any required entry documentation for their destination. Passport and visa requirements vary by nationality and destination country.

For the most accurate and up-to-date information, please visit the UK Government’s official Foreign Travel Advice page:
www.gov.uk/foreign-travel-advice

For UK passport guidance, renewals, and validity requirements, please visit:
UK Passport Guidance

Travellers should check:

  • Passport validity requirements (including minimum validity periods)
  • Visa requirements and electronic travel authorisations
  • Entry documentation for children or minors
  • Any country-specific immigration rules or restrictions

Health Advice

It is the traveller’s responsibility to ensure they meet all health requirements for their destination, including required or recommended vaccinations and entry-related health regulations.

For general health guidance, please check:
NHS Travel Vaccinations

Additional country-specific health guidance is available via the UK National Travel Health Network (NaTHNaC):
TravelHealthPro – Country Health Advice

For travel within the EU, a valid GHIC/EHIC may be required for access to state-provided healthcare. More information is available at:
www.nhs.uk/using-the-nhs/healthcare-abroad/

Travel Insurance Advice

Par5 Escapes strongly recommends that all travellers obtain comprehensive travel insurance at the time of booking. A suitable policy should cover, at minimum:

  • Medical emergencies and healthcare
  • Trip cancellations, curtailment, or delays
  • Loss or damage of personal belongings or baggage
  • Golf equipment and sports-related activities (where applicable)
  • Unexpected events or emergencies

Travellers are responsible for ensuring their insurance policy is adequate for the destination and activities involved. Par5 Escapes is not liable for any losses arising from failure to obtain suitable cover.

ABTA Membership & Code of Conduct

Par5 Escapes is a Member of ABTA and adheres to the ABTA Code of Conduct, which provides customers with high service standards, fair trading, and a structured complaints process.

The ABTA Code of Conduct can be found here:
www.abta.com/about-us/abta-code-conduct

If a complaint cannot be resolved, travellers may be entitled to use ABTA’s Alternative Dispute Resolution (ADR) scheme.

Please note:
Flight-inclusive packages sold by Par5 Escapes are protected by the ATOL of the third-party supplier providing the holiday. Par5 Escapes does not provide ATOL protection directly.
